Plugin authors: the Glintframe image cache leaks when thumbnails are evicted mid-decode. Until patch 4.2 ships, call `cache.release()` explicitly in your teardown hook. Skipping this balloons heap usage by ~40 MB per hour under load. To verify your fix, post heap snapshots to the Heapwatch diagnostics endpoint. Authenticate requests to Heapwatch with the key below.

service key, tadup-tahog: zpat7_wB1tnEL

## Artifact Signing for Catalogue Imports

Every import bundle produced by the Lanternwick catalogue pipeline must be signed before the Quillbrook ingest service will accept it. This protects the shared index from tampered or truncated record batches, which caused real damage in the past. As a contractor, you will sign bundles locally using the team's shared tooling; the verifier rejects anything unsigned. The key you need for this is shown immediately below.

deploy key for kajof-fajop: bky6_gDHw9Q

Finance Review — Regional Sales Summary

Northern region up 6%, driven by Pellway renewals. Coastal region flat; two large accounts slipped to Q4. Inland region down 9% on distributor churn. Expense discipline held across all branches. Forecast for next quarter remains conservative pending the Harwick contract decision. Branch managers should review variance reports before the call with Marta Insley. Confidential planning details are provided directly below.

board note of kageg-bahof: The renewal with Holwynax Holdings closes at $2 million a year, 5 percent below the last contract. Project Ulaath slips by two quarters because of the supplier delay.

## Deployment

The Glintharbor gateway supports hot-reloading: edits to its config file are picked up within seconds, no restart required. A watcher validates each change before applying it; invalid files are rejected and the previous config stays active, with a warning in the logs. Always deploy config changes to the canary node first and watch for the "reload applied" log line before rolling wider. A fresh checkout ships with these defaults.

settings of fafog-haduf:
ZORIX_PIN=4648
ZORIX_METRICS_HOST=metrics.zorix.paliqsys.corp
ZORIX_LOG_LEVEL=info
ZORIX_TENANT=druix